Ditto, I level my tripod so that for polar alignment, the altitude of the mount will be close to correct (saves time).

As for azimuth, I use a star near the east/west horizon as the reference - look up its dec and set the mount to that declination, rotate in azimuth to centre this in a finderscope.

This is is good enough for visual, but for imaging I'll refine it using a camera and SharpCap.
